Detailed Description

Referring to fig. 1-2, a cloth cleaning, drying and collecting device for automatic production comprises a conveyor belt frame 1, the conveyor belt frame 1 is a prior art, which is not described herein, a guiding device is arranged on the conveyor belt frame 1, further, the guiding device comprises inclined rods 9 fixedly connected to two sides of the conveyor belt frame 1, two inclined rods 9 are rotatably connected with a same flattening roller 10, the cloth is limited on the conveyor belt frame 1 by the flattening roller 10 connected with the inclined rods 9, it is ensured that the conveying of the cloth on a conveyor belt is not affected, i.e. the processing of the previous process is not affected, a fixing frame 11 is fixedly connected to a side wall of a processing chamber 3, an adjusting roller 12 is arranged in the fixing frame 11 in an inclined manner, the adjusting roller 12 realizes the conversion of the cloth angle, the cloth is converted from horizontal to vertical, the subsequent processing is facilitated, the adjusting roller 12 is connected with two sides of the fixing frame 11 through, inside the fixed frame 11 is provided a vertical roller 13.
A base 2 is arranged on one side of the conveyor belt frame 1, a processing chamber 3 is fixedly connected on the base 2, a plurality of isolation plates 4 are fixedly connected at the bottom of the processing chamber 3, and by arranging the isolation plates, the liquid is distinguished to realize the recycling of the liquid, the top of the processing chamber 3 is provided with a horizontal motor 5, the horizontal motor 5 is the prior art, not described in detail, the output end of the horizontal motor 5 is connected with a cleaning device, further, the cleaning device comprises a plurality of vertical pipes 14 fixedly connected with the side walls of the two sides of the processing chamber 3, a plurality of spray heads are arranged on the vertical pipes 14, a circulating cavity is arranged on the base 2 at the bottom of the vertical pipes 14, a high-pressure pump 15 is arranged in the circulating cavity, the high-pressure pump 15 is prior art, and the high-pressure pump 15 is connected with the vertical pipes 14 at two sides through a connecting pipe, and a water storage channel penetrating to the circulating cavity is formed at the bottom of the processing chamber 3.
Further, the 5 output ends of the horizontal motor are connected with an upper chain wheel, the bottom of the processing chamber 3 is provided with a mounting groove, a lower chain wheel is arranged in the mounting groove, the upper chain wheel is connected with the lower chain wheel through a chain 16, the side wall of the chain 16 is fixedly connected with cleaning cloth 17, a soft brush layer is arranged on the cleaning cloth 17, and the brush layer is in direct contact with the cloth.
Still further, the side walls of the two sides of the processing chamber 3 are fixedly connected with a plurality of air pipes 18, the side walls of the air pipes 18 are provided with air blowing openings, one end of each air pipe 18 is connected with an air blower 19, and the air blowers 19 are the prior art and are not described herein in detail.
Two vertical shafts which are oppositely arranged are arranged in the base 2, a pressing roller 6 is arranged on each vertical shaft, a vertical motor 7 is arranged in each base 2, the output end of each vertical motor 7 penetrates through the side wall of each base 2 to extend upwards and is connected with a rotating chassis 8, a collecting device is arranged on each rotating chassis 8, further, each collecting device comprises a supporting frame 20 fixedly connected to each base 2, a moving groove is formed in each supporting frame 20, a through hole is formed in the top of each moving groove, a pressing post 21 is arranged in each through hole, a fixing ring is rotatably connected to the top of each pressing post 21 and is connected with the top of each supporting frame 20 through a spring sleeved on the outer side wall of each pressing post 21, a cross groove is formed in each rotating chassis 8, a cross shaft 22 is arranged on each rotating chassis 8, a collision groove is formed in the top of each cross shaft 22 and is in contact, the outer side wall of the cross shaft 22 is connected with four connecting strips corresponding to the cross grooves, and the rotating chassis 8 drives the cross shaft 22 to rotate through the cooperation of the connecting strips and the cross grooves.
In the utility model
When the cloth cleaning machine is used, cloth is limited on the conveying belt frame 1 through the flattening rollers 10 which are arranged on the conveying belt frame 1 and connected through the inclined rods 9, and the cloth is changed from horizontal to vertical through the adjusting rollers 12 and the vertical rollers 13 which are arranged on the fixing frame 11 on the side wall of the processing chamber 3 in an inclined mode, so that the cloth is convenient to clean and collect;
the water with washing liquid is sprayed to the cloth which is vertically transported in the processing chamber 3 through a high-pressure pump 15 arranged in the processing chamber 3, the chain 16 is driven by a horizontal motor 5 to rotate under the action of an upper chain wheel and a lower chain wheel, so that the transported cloth is washed through washing cloth 17 fixed on the side wall of the chain 16, the moving cloth is rubbed and washed through the movement of the chain 16, the surface is effectively washed, the washed cloth is pressed and dried through two pressing rollers 6 arranged in the processing chamber 3, most of moisture in the cloth is reduced, the cloth is blown and dried through an air pipe 18 arranged in the processing chamber 3 and an air blower 19 connected with the air pipe 18, and the cloth can be quickly dried;
the collecting cylinder is sleeved on the cross shaft 22, the connecting strips on the cross shaft 22 are inserted into the cross grooves in the rotating chassis 8 to realize connection, the fixing ring is pulled to press the pressing columns 21 connected with the cross shaft 22 and the fixing ring, the vertical motor 7 is started, the rotating chassis 8 is driven by the vertical motor 7 to rotate, the collecting cylinder on the cross shaft 22 is driven to rotate, and therefore collection of cloth after cleaning and drying are completed is achieved.
